Re: [PATCH] libsepol/cil: Allow dotted names in aliasactual rules

> The function cil_gen_alias() is used to declare type, sensitivity,
> and category aliases and the function cil_gen_aliasactual() is used
> to assign an alias to the actual declared name.
>
> Commit e55621c03 ("libsepol/cil: Add notself and other support to CIL")
> added "notself" and "other" as reserved words. Previously, a check
> was made in cil_gen_aliasactual() to ensure that the "self" reserved
> word was not used. With the notself patch this function was upgraded
> to call cil_verify_name() to verify that the other reserved words
> were not used as well. This change prevents the use of dotted names
> to refer to alias or actual names that are declared in blocks.
>
> The check for a reserved word being used is not needed because that
> check will be done for both the alias and the actual name when they
> are declared.
>
> Remove the call to cil_verify_name() and allow dotted names in
> aliasactual rules.
